Output 81e68013ce32f237bef40d96a8bceaf3f8b6f8b43df9cae0ee8110019c636296:1

value
2263058
script pubkey
OP_0 OP_PUSHBYTES_20 e80e9eff39236dd9bd4bb6a0e7de8ce7d5438132
address
ltc1qaq8faleeydkan02tk6sw0h5vul258qfj4s5dgf
transaction
81e68013ce32f237bef40d96a8bceaf3f8b6f8b43df9cae0ee8110019c636296
spent
true